Former Arnolds Park Man Sentenced In Florida In Connection With Child Predator Investigation

November 22, 2014


(Sarasota Fl.)—A former Arnolds Park man has been sentenced after entering a no-contest plea to charges of using a computer to solicit, seduce or entice a child to commit sex acts and travel to solicit, seduce or entice a child to commit sex acts.

Frederick Joseph Wilson was sentenced last week in Sarasota county, Florida. He was booked into jail to resume serving a five-year sentence. In addition, Wilson will also be listed on the Florida sex offender registry and must serve five years of probation once the jail sentence is completed.

The charges stemmed from an investigation in May of last year into an alleged child predator operation in the Sarasota area. The sting investigation resulted in the arrests of 30 people.
